Histórico da Página
...
Mapeamento de Campos da Mensagem Única MaintenanceOrder (Ordem de Manutenção) - Protheus
Mensagem Única | RMMNT | Observação | ||
---|---|---|---|---|
Elemento | Descrição | Tabela | Coluna | |
BusinessContent | ||||
InternalId | InternalId da Solicitação | STJ | cEmpAnt | | |
Code | Id da Solicitação | STJ | TJ_ORDEM |
|
Number | Numero da Solicitação | STJ | TJ_ORDEM | |
CompanyId | Coligada | cEmpAnt | ||
BranchId | Filial | cFilAnt | ||
CompanyInternalId | Empresa e Filial | CEmpAnt|cFilAnt | ||
Status |
Situação da OS |
STJ |
TJ_SITUACA e TJ_TERMINO | Utiliza a combinação de campos para montar um status fixo para a OS: |
AssetInternalId | Ativo fixo da OS | SN1 | cEmpAnt | N1_FILIAL | | |
UserRequesterCode | Código do Usuário Solicitante | STJ | TJ_USUARIO | |
AccountableUserInternalID | Usuário Responsável | Composto por: empresa + '|’ + código (6 caracteres) + ‘|’ + nome do usuário | ||
RegisterDateTime | Data de Emissão | STJ | TJ_DTORIGI + ’00:00:00’ | |
MaintenanceServiceCode | Serviço da manutenção | STJ | TJ_SERVICO | |
FirstCounter | Contador de utilização 1 | STJ ou ST9 | TJ_POSCONT ou T9_POSCONT | Utiliza TJ_POSCONT, mas por não ser obrigatório em tela envia T9_POSCONT quando não informado. |
SecondCounter | Contador de utilização 2 | STJ ou TPE | TJ_POSCON2 ou TPE_POSCON | |
ProjectInternalId | Projeto da OS | STJ | IntPrjExt() -> TJ_INTPRJ | |
TaskInternalId | Tarefa da OS | STJ | IntTrfExt() -> TJ_INTTSK | |
Observation | Observação | STJ | TJ_OBSERVA | |
ListOfMaintenanceOrderItem .MaintenanceOrderItem | ||||
Event | Evento | UPSERT ou DELETE | ||
InternalId |
InternalID |
STL | cEmpAnt | | |
Code | Id do Item | |||
ItemInternalId | Produto | SB1 / STL | IntProExt() -> *TL_CODIGO | TL_CODIGO é composto conforme regras e parametrizações de integração: |
ItemReferenceCode | Codigo de Ref. do Produto | ‘1’ | ||
UnitPrice | Preço Unitário | STL | TL_CUSTO / TL_QUANTID | Divisão do custo pela quantidade. |
TotalPrice | Valor total do item | STL | TL_CUSTO | |
Quantity | Quantidade | STL | TL_QUANTID | |
InitialDateTime | Início da utilização | STL | TL_DTINICI + TL_HOINICI | |
FinalDateTime | Final da utilização | STL | TL_DTFIM + TL_HOFIM | |
UnitofMeasureInternalId | Unidade de Medida | SAH / STL | IntUndExt() -> AH_FILIAL | TL_UNIDADE | |
WarehouseInternalId | Local de Estoque | NNR / STL | IntLocExt() -> | |
ProjectInternalId | ID do Projeto | |||
TaskInternalId | ID da Tarefa | |||
Observation | Observação | |||
ListOfApportionRequest.ApportionRequest - não enviado pelo MNT |